If the temperature exceeds more than 50 deg celsius as per the code, the microcontroller will turn on the relay to start the fan. The project temperature controlled fan using arduino is simply fabricated around arduino uno board and temperature sensor lm35. This simple temperature controlled dc fan circuit can be used to control any 12 volt 1a dc fan by activating it on a preset temperature. Automatic room temperature controlled fan speed controller using pt100 article pdf available in international journal of scientific and engineering research 68. The max1669 fan controller includes a precise digital thermometer that reports the temperature of a remote sensor. Automatic temperature controlled fan full circuit diagram. Here is circuit diagram of automatic temperature controlled dc fan controller. Simple temperature controlled dc fan circuit diagram. The circuit is very simple and using only five components. The basic working principle of temperature controlled dc fan is based on the thermistor. This circuit adopt a rather old design technique as its purpose is to vary the speed of a fan related to temperature with a minimum parts counting and avoiding the use of specialpurpose ics, often difficult to obtain. Temperature controlled fan regulator circuitautomatic fan. Arduino uno is the heart of this project and a l293d driver ic is used to drive the dc fan motor. In this mini project, we are going to control the speed of the dc fan automatically as the surrounding temperature changes.
So any of vr1, thermistor, r1 are part of making fan start or stop. Alternatively, the same circuit can be used for automatic temperature controlled ac power control. Mar 31, 2016 this circuit can cool your heat generating electronic devices by operating a dc fan when the temperature in its vicinity increases above the preset level. Oct 06, 2012 trying to build a temperature controlled heater. The circuit mainly consists of atmega8 microcontroller. Temperature controlled dc fan electronic circuits and. Mar 22, 20 now, here is the circuit of automatic temperature controlled fan used to control the speed of fan according to change in temperature. Two thermistors r1 and r2 are used to sense the temperature.
Temperature controlled fan using arduino engineering. The main principle of the circuit is to switch on the fan connected to dc motor when the temperature is greater than a threshold value. This temperature controlled fan circuit is highly efficient as it uses thyristors for power control. I offer the ideas above as normal inspiration however clearly there are questions just like the one you convey up where crucial thing will be working in sincere good faith.
In this circuit, the temperature sensor used is an ntc thermistor, i. This circuit uses thermister which senses the heat and automatic switch on an switch off the fan this is best for power amplifiers, cpus and other electronic devices that get more heat and need to control of temperature for cooling. In a normal pc or notebook pc, most of the heat generated is by the processor. The projects are good example of embedded system basically designed using closedlooped feedback control system. Temperature controlled dc fan using microcontroller mindsforest. For proper user interface visual indication we had also used lcd which indicate temperature as well as speed of fan. Here we are going to make a temperature controlled dc fan. This sensor is pulled for new data at a constant interval and will activate the high voltage circuit when the temperature becomes too hot. Temperature controlled dc fan using thermistor circuit digest. Automatic room temperature controlled fan using arduino uno. You can use this idea in your own laptop or you can make your own ventilat. In the following circuit, the pic16f877a microcontroller is used to control the fan speed according to the change in room temperature. Temperature controlled fan can be used to control the temperature of devices, rooms, electronic components etc. If the temperature drops below 40 deg celsius as per the code.
Temperature controlled dc fan using microcontroller core. Temperature controlled fan using arduino hobby project. This change is reflected on the fan speed by regulating the current to the fans motor. As the temperature of the device increases or decreases, the speed of fan.
The temperature sensor output is read by the arduino and the software establishes the desired fan speed for a. When the temperature increases the base current of q1 bc 547 increases. The block diagram of the temperature controlled fan using a microcontroller is shown in the above figure. Most modern motherboards include a provision for on board cpu fan control.
Feb 10, 2012 i want the fan to run at 3v but when the temperature reaches or goes over 50c it will then run the fan at 5v till the temperature goes below 50c so below 50c fan runs at 3v 50c and over 5v the input voltage for this device will be 5v maybe add a potentiometr vr1 so i can set what temperature the fan runs at 5v here is a very quick pic of what. You can use this circuit in many electronic projects, which require a cooling fan. The circuit was designed using electronic components available in local market to keep the cost at low leve. The diagram of fan speed control system shown in fig. Temperature sensor has three input pins, vcc, ground. A pc fan along with a heat sink is an excellent active cooling system for computers. When the temperature is below 90f, the output will be off, when its above 90f it will be on. Automatically control the fan speed by sensing the room temperature. Temperature controlled dc fan using atmega8 microcontroller. How to make a temperaturecontrolled fan using arduino.
Pwm is a technique by using which we can control voltage. Dht22 sensor is used to sense the room temperature and then we adjust speed of a dc fan motor accordingly using pwm pulse width modulation. In this article, you are going to learn about arduino temperature controlled fan using dht22 sensor and relay. The block diagram includes power supply, rst circuit, 8051 microcontrollers, lm35 temperature sensor, 8 bit adc, l293d motor driver, dc motor, 7segment display, ip switches. Regulated voltage is coarse, but good enough and watch the output. Fan speed control system circuit design this section describes how the speed of fan is controlled by output from microcontroller, with the change in room temperature. The circuit can be used at any place where a 12v supply.
How to make temperature controlled 12v dc fan circuit at. These two circuits use thermistors temperature dependent resistors. This is to certify that the work in the thesis entitled temperature controlled dc fan using microcontroller by ghana shyam soren, bearing roll number 111ee0236, and ram ashish gupta, bearing roll number 111ee0211, is a record of an original research work carried out by them under my. Circuit diagram of the temperaturebased fan speed control and monitoring using arduino circuit diagram of the temperature fan speed control and monitoring is shown in fig. Temperature controlled dc fan using thermistor mini. A simple circuit can regulate the fan speed according to temperature. Circuit description of arduino based temperature controlled fan the circuit shown in figure 1 is designed arduino nano, lm35 temperature sensor, optocoupler 4n35, igbt fga25n120 and few other electronics components as shown in figure below.
The temperature based fan speed control system can be done by using an electronic circuit using an arduino board. Aug 15, 2017 if the temperature exceeds more than 50 deg celsius as per the code, the microcontroller will turn on the relay to start the fan. Mar 11, 2017 the thermistor is a component which changes its resistance as its temperature changes. Its an ideal addon for your pc cooling fans to eliminate produced noise. The circuit diagram of the fan speed control system is shown below. The circuit is from here which gives a good writeup. Pdf automatic temperature controlled household electric. Please wash your hands and practise social distancing. Temperature controlled fan using arduino use arduino for. Circuit is constructed using arduino uno and lm35 temperature sensor and other components.
In this project i have tried to explain how to built temperature controlled fan with an arduino basically i have used transistor in order to drive motor. Now arduino board is very progressive among all electronic circuits, thus we employed arduino board for fan speed control. The block diagram of the temperaturecontrolled fan using a microcontroller is shown in the above figure. Circuit description of temperature controlled fan using arduino. Temperature controlled fan using 8051 microcontroller. Automatic fan speed control using pic16f877a microcontroller. The proposed system is designed to detect the temperature of the room and send that information to the. An alarm circuit is also attached to indicate the fan turn on. How to make temperature controlled 12v dc fan circuit at home. Dht22 sensor is used to sense the room temperature and then we adjust speed of a dc fanmotor accordingly using pwm pulse width modulation.
The thermistor is a component which changes its resistance as its temperature changes. We will use the dht22 sensor to get the temperature value and we. The temperature controlled dc fan is designed to turn off and. Requested by some correspondents, this simple design allows an accurate speed control of 12v dc fan motors, proportional to temperature. The eye of the milcandy, aka temperature sensor, should be connected to the input side of milcandy. Slow the fan too much and the fan cant keep the temperature down, the temperature rises, the thermistor heats, its resistance drops, the mosfet gets driven harder the fan speeds up the emvironment cools, we are all happy. If your ac mains is rated at about 115v, you can change r9 value to 15k 2w.
Only three components are needed to allow the fan speed to be controlled according to the actual temperature. It is accomplished by the data communications between arduino, lcd, dht11 sensor module and dc fan that is controlled by using pwm. The figure below shows a circuit of an automatic temperature controlled fan using 555. This fan regulator circuit will automatically control the speed of your fan according to the temperature. Max1669 fan controller and remote temperature sensor with. If u have questions about driving motor with transistor just have a look at this article and watch the video i hope.
This sensor and fan project was built to record and manage the heat produced by a 3d printer in homemade enclosure to ensure a safe, and controlled temperature within the enclosure. Dec 10, 2019 if the temperature exceeds more than 50 deg celsius as per the code, the microcontroller will turn on the relay to start the fan. Circuit 2 temperature controlled dc fan using atmega8 circuit diagram. This mode of operation is useful in controlling a hot air flux, e. Temperature controlled fans for gas fireplace equivalent transistors and. This project should reduce the amount of temperature fluctuation and improve the quality of the 3d prints by reducing the effects of inconsistent plastic shrinkage. How to make temperature controlled 12v dc fan circuit at home 12899 20. Temperature controlled dc fan using thermistor mini project.
Gradually increases speed as temperature increases. And the hand, aka relay, should be connected to the output side of it. The circuit mainly consists of atmega8 microcontroller, temperature sensor, dc motor, driver ic. Temperature sensor is connected to the input of the adc pin i. Temperature based fan speed control and monitoring using arduino.
Automatic room temperature controlled fan speed controller is one of them. You can use this idea in your own laptop or you can make your own ventilator for the hot summer days. May 26, 2017 in this arduino based project, we are going to control dc fan speed according to the room temperature and show these parameter changes on a 16. In this project i have tried to explain how to built temperature controlled fan with an arduinobasically i have used transistor in order to drive motor. There are definitely a variety of details like that to take into consideration. Pdf automatic room temperature controlled fan speed. In temperature controlled dc fan, we have used an ntc type thermistor.
The circuit will control the speed of the fan automatically according to the temperature. Automatic room temperature controlled fan using arduino uno microcontroller 1. Temperature controlled dc fan using thermistor youtube. This circuit can cool your heat generating electronic devices by operating a dc fan when the temperature in its vicinity increases above the preset level. When the temperature increases the base current of q1 bc 547 increases which in turn decreases the collector voltage. Temperature controlled dc fan using microcontroller youtube. You can use any type and size of 12v dc fan marked 1 to 1. Temperature controlled dc fan using microcontroller. In this arduino based project, we are going to control dc fan speed according to the room temperature and show these parameter changes on a 16x2 lcd display. The circuit of automatic temperature controlled fan is build around temperature transducer ad590 followed by operational amplifier lm324. Here is a simple circuit based on two transistors that can be used to control the speed of a 12 v dc fan depending on the temperature. Temperature controlled pc fan circuit wiring diagrams.
Temperature controlled fan and data recorder hackster. Hello friends, in this post we are going to make one simple mini project which is temperature controlled dc fan using a thermistor. Jan 21, 2015 the main principle of the circuit is to switch on the fan connected to dc motor when the temperature is greater than a threshold value. In this circuit, pin 3 noninverting terminal of op amp 741 is connected with the potentiometer and pin 2 inverting terminal is connected in between of r2 and rt1 thermistor which is making a voltage divider circuit. Automatic temperature controlled fan electronics project. This not only saves energy, it also reduces fan noise. In this project the main intension is to control the fan by heating the sensor, i. My temperature controlled fan circuit has a liquid crystal display connected to the arduino to display the temperature in celsius and fan speed 50255 pwm this controls the duty cycle of the fan which then controls the fan speed. Temperature controlled fan using 555 circuit diagram.
The circuit works almost like the published here previously. The fan is on when v from vr1 is greater than v from r1 and thermistor. Automatic temperature controlled househ old electric ceiling fan. Temperaturecontrolled usb fan using arduino use arduino. Working of temperature controlled dc fan using thermistor. Automatic temperature controlled fan using thermistor. Download project code circuit 2 temperature controlled dc. In this step, find two grove cables to connect all the stuff. The circuit was designed using electronic components available in local. The entire circuit of temperature controlled fan using arduino utilize very few components, a mcu arduino uno, a temperature sensor lm35, a lcd, a motor fan, a transistor and few other passive components etc.
Now, here is the circuit of automatic temperature controlled fan used to control the speed of fan according to change in temperature. Arduino based temperature controlled fan engineering projects. We will use the dht22 sensor to get the temperature value and we will print this temperature value on the lcd. Download project code circuit 2 temperature controlled dc fan using atmega8 circuit diagram. The key component of this temperature controlled fan circuit is thermistor, which has been used to detect the rise in temperature. Nov, 2017 working of temperature controlled dc fan using thermistor. Temperature controlled fan using arduino engineering projects. Temperature controlled dc fan using thermistor slideshare.
Arduino uno is the heart of this project and a l293d driver ic is used to drive the dc fanmotor. Nov 24, 2016 automatic room temperature controlled fan using arduino uno microcontroller 1. The proposed system gives an overview of how the fan speed is controlled using pic16f877a microcontroller, with the change in room temperature. After setting the temperature control system to a desired temperature, known as a set point. The remote sensor is a diodeconnected transistortypically a lowcost, easily mounted 2n3906 pnp typereplacing conventional thermistor. The circuit can be used for car engine to reduce the heat. Automatic room temperature controlled fan using arduino. Temperature controlled fan with an arduino instructables. With this simple circuit you will be able to control the speed of a dc fan according to temperature measured by a temp sensor.
1066 1396 673 258 779 516 559 1441 166 1366 808 892 816 1020 507 494 884 208 1229 734 1260 877 969 862 87 395 575 1222 1093 1179 127 573 778 619 164 1177 1340 1339 593 884 1483 1326 1294 189 35